First Class Email Tips and Tricks

Quickly Handling Attachments:
Attachments come in all shapes and forms. We all know the procedure for handling them.

  1. Open the email message
  2. Double click on the name of the attachment
  3. Select a place to store the attachment
  4. Click on SAVE in the resulting dialogue to save the attachment to your hard drive
  5. Exit First Class
  6. Open the second application that will process the attachment
  7. Locate the attachment on your computer
  8. Open the attachment and do what you will with it

But there's a quicker way.

If your computer has the second application installed properly then your computer knows what documents that application is capable of opening. For example, WordPerfect documents, properly saved, should end with the extension .WPD.

Next time you get an attachment, hold down the CTRL key as you double click on the name of the attachment. Instead of simply saving the attachment to your hard drive, your computer will open the appropriate application and automatically load the document for you. What a terrific timesaver.

Check out the picture below. Angela has emailed me the December 1998 calendar for Colchester North Public School. I CTRL/Double Clicked on it and WordPerfect has automatically opened on top of my First Class program. I can now edit the calendar directly without jumping through all the hurdles outlined above.

It may take a little practice to change the way you view attachments but the time that you save in the long run definitely makes learning the procedure worthwhile.
